Mort
Mort is a brilliant exploration of Death and the concept of mortality, told through the eyes of Mort, Death's reluctant apprentice. The book is both hilarious and surprisingly poignant, examining themes of responsibility, destiny, and the value of life. Sourcery
Sourcery follows Rincewind as he is reluctantly thrust into the role of a sorcerer's apprentice. The book explores the dangers of unchecked power and the importance of responsibility. While it's a bit more uneven than some of Pratchett's later works, it still offers plenty of humor and adventure.
